My new project 88' 951 had the original window sticker in the glovebox and the total was $40,940.

Seems like I remember someone posted a picture of their window sticker not too long ago for theirs and it was close to 48k.

From the few leather dashes I've seen, it looks like only the lower half is leather. The '86 parts car I had didn't have the lower dash in leather, but it did have a leather glovebox door (the interior was burgundy). It had script seats and the standard vinyl door cards and center console. I recovered the glovebox door and used it in my '87 because the original leather had mold growing on it, but the plastic door stops were in perfect shape.
